How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Sunnyside?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Sunnyside Studio Apartments | $2,372 | $2,095 | $2,650 |
| Sunnyside 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,700 | $1,700 | $3,600 |
Sunnyside 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,500 | $3,500 | $3,500 |
| Sunnyside 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,500 | $3,500 | $3,500 |
